#4b5743 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4b5743 is composed of 29.4% red, 34.1%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 23% yellow and 65.9% black. It has a hue angle of 96 degrees, a saturation of 13% and a lightness of 30.2%. #4b5743 color hex could be obtained by blending #96ae86 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#4b5743 color description : Very dark grayish green.

#4b5743 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#4b5743 has RGB values of R:75, G:87, B:67 and CMYK values of C:0.14, M:0, Y:0.23, K:0.66. Its decimal value is 4937539.

Shades and Tints of #4b5743

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080907 is the darkest color, while #fefef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#4b5743

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4c5149 is the less saturated color, while #3e9802 is the most saturated one.
